A BROMSGROVE couple were among several families who got an extra-special Christmas present as they welcomed a new addition to the family.

Marie and Gary Williams’ baby daughter was on of the first to arrive on the special day, at 8.45am, at Worcestershire Royal Hospital, weighing six pounds and 9.5 ounces.

Mrs Williams said it had been a surprise – but a welcome one – to say hello to their new daughter, who they have called Krissie, as she had not been due until January 15.

She added they had decided on the name far in advance, but were expecting to field endless questions on whether they had decided on the name in honour of her birthday.

“If she was a boy we were going to call her Christopher after my dad,” she said.

Mr Williams described it as “the best Christmas present ever” and said he had joked they should give her the middle name ‘massday’.

Mrs Williams added their older daughter, six-year-old Chelsie, was excited to meet her baby sister.

“She’s been crying all day because she had to stay at home,” she said.

She added both herself and baby Krissie were doing well.
